Designing An Open-Source Power Inverter (Part 18): Transformer Winding Design For The Battery Converter—Secondary Winding Design Focus: In the most recent installment in the Volksinverter design series, part 17, the previously
derived winding design procedure and formulas were used to evaluate various winding
configurations for the primary winding in the battery converter’s transformer. In this
part, the same basic design procedure is now applied to the design of the secondary
winding. Plans W through Y, which are described here, follow the scheme of electrically
paralleling multiple layers to maximize window utilization. Plan Z changes the winding
configuration to multifilar.
What you’ll learn: - How to determine transformer winding configurations to maximize window utilization and
minimize eddy current losses
